Mela 7.14: Pitch-to-Amp, Vel-to-Amp, and Improved Patch Browsing
Mela 7.14 refines Vel-to-Amp by replacing its Curve parameter with a more predictable Range control. To complement it, the update introduces Pitch-to-Amp. It works similarly to Vel-to-Amp, but uses the Pitch signal rather than velocity to control audio levels. Together, these modules offer a faster way to shape levels than configuring equivalent modulation manually. For example, in an FM Matrix setup, Vel-to-Amp can make the timbre respond to note velocity, while Pitch-to-Amp can attenuate high-frequency modulators as pitch rises, helping reduce aliasing.
Pitch-to-Amp’s Range parameter determines how much the level changes across the pitch range. Positive values make higher pitches louder and lower pitches quieter, while negative values do the opposite. Center selects the pitch that retains its original level, and in Poly mode each voice is processed independently.
The Patch Library now also includes a Latest smart folder, making newly added factory patches easy to find and browse by Mela version.

Mela 7.14 Changelog
Pitch-to-Amp
- The new Pitch-to-Amp module uses the Pitch signal to control audio levels.
- Range sets how much the audio level changes across the pitch range. Positive values make higher pitches louder and lower pitches quieter. Negative values do the opposite.
- Center sets the pitch that keeps its original audio level.
- In Poly mode, level is applied independently to each voice.
- Pitch-to-Amp is a Mela Lab module and part of Collection 5.
Vel-to-Amp
- Replaced Curve with the Range parameter for more predictable dynamics.
Patch Management
- Patch Library: Added a Latest smart folder for browsing newly added factory patches grouped by Mela version.
- Patch Library: Added a Copy action to patch menus, including factory patches.
- Patch Renaming: Saving a patch while editing its name now uses the new name instead of the previous one.
- Factory Patches: Added “Matrix Taps” to the Audio FX folder, demonstrating how the Matrix module can be used to create a feature-rich multi-tap delay.
- Factory Patches: Added “Lo-Fi Keys” and “Sad FM” to the Keys folder.
- Factory Patches: Added “Lethal” to the Pads folder.
Other Changes
- Splitter: Graduated from Mela Lab to the Signal Router category.
- Phasor-based modules: Improved timing accuracy, preventing gradual drift at slow rates.
- Fixed an issue where tempo-synced modules could incorrectly initialise their timing at 120 BPM after the host reset the plug-in.
- Fixed MIDI-to-Poly modules sometimes displaying inconsistent polyphony settings after loading a patch.
